The article presents information about the book "Robert E. Lee, the Soldier," by Frederick Maurice. It is a remarkable volume, not only for its conciseness but also for its admirable style, its clearness, its extraordinary tearing away of technical details in order to present the narrative of military events in such a way that the lay reader can follow with ease. What lends still greater interest to it is the fact that General Maurice has applied to Commander in Chief Robert E. Lee's career the new measuring stick afforded by the military experiences of the World War.
